What is perpendicular to y=1/3x+6 and passes through the point (2,-3)

Respuesta :

fnej
fnej fnej
  • 12-03-2021

Answer:

y = -3x + 3

Step-by-step explanation:

Perpendicular slope: -3

y -(-3)= -3(x-2)

y+3= -3x + 6

y = -3x + 3
